Where is the one-touch window control for the Encore?
2 Answers
On the driver's door armrest, below is an introduction to the one-touch window feature: One-touch window feature introduction: By operating a single button, you can open or close all the windows on the vehicle. Smart key one-touch window: Control the one-touch window function using the lock and unlock buttons on the smart key. The owner only needs to hold the lock button on the key for about 3 seconds, and all four window glasses will rise simultaneously; then hold the unlock button for more than 3 seconds, and all windows will lower and open. The one-touch window function on the smart key is very convenient, allowing the owner to lock the windows if they forget to close them after getting out of the car.
